    Based on the maximum principle of an \(n\times n\) matrix \(A\), the weighted maximum principle of an \(n\times n\) matrix \(A\) with respect to a fixed positive vector \(\gamma\) is introduced and discussed. For an invertible matrix \(A\) with positive inverse, the \(\gamma\)-weighted maximum principle is characterized geometrically by means of the behavior under \(A^{- 1}\) of convex boundary parts of the simplex generated in \(R^ n_ +\) by permissible multiples of the unit coordinate vectors. Sufficient conditions for the maximum principle are generalized to the \(\gamma\)- weighted maximum principle. The \(\gamma\)-weighted maximum principle for \(M\)-matrices is presented.
